JEE Main 2026 score calculator helps applicants to predict their raw scores, expected percentile, and probable rank using the final answer key. The score calculator helps students by analysing their performance and to find their chances of admission in NITs, IITs, and other colleges. By using the calculator, candidates can predict their marks even before the official JEE Main result are released. It also helps students understand how to calculate JEE Main marks from answer key online. The score calculator follows the official JEE Main 2026 marking scheme to calculate the scores. Candidates need to count all the correct and incorrect answers and apply the formula. Candidates can follow these steps to calculate their expected marks:
Log in to the official portal and download your response sheet and JEE Main 2026 answer key.
Copy the complete response sheet URL
Paste that URL into the “JEE Main 2026 score calculator.”
Click submit to view your raw marks, subject-wise score and expected percentile.
After calculating the raw score, candidates can use the JEE Main 2026 marks vs percentile analysis to estimate their expected percentile.

The calculation is based on the official marking scheme. Candidates must understand the marking pattern first.
| Particulars | Details |
|---|---|
Exam Mode | Computer-based exam |
Duration | 3 hours |
Type of Question | MCQ |
JEE Main Negative Marking | 4 marks will be awarded for all correct answers 1 mark will be deducted for all incorrect answers |
Formula of JEE Main Score Calculation:
JEE Main score = (Correct Answers × 4) − (Incorrect Answers × 1)
The authority will convert your raw marks into a percentile using the normalisation process. The percentile depends on the overall performance of the candidate and the difficulty level of the exam. The percentile shows the relatives’ performance. The rank is calculated based on the percentile across the session.
| Marks | Percentile |
|---|---|
300-291 | 100-99.999 |
292-280 | 99.99890732 - 99.99617561 |
279-271 | 99.99417236 - 99.99153171 |
268-259 | 99.99034797 - 99.97687156 |
258-250 | 99.97413985 - 99.95228621 |
249-240 | 99.95028296 - 99.91549924 |
239-230 | 99.91395128 - 99.87060821 |
229-220 | 99.86150253 - 99.78191884 |
219-210 | 99.77499852 - 99.69159044 |
209- 200 | 99.68494329 - 99.57503767 |
199-190 | 99.56019541 - 99.40858575 |
189- 180 | 99.39319714 - 99.17311273 |
179-170 | 99.1567225 - 98.87981861 |
169-160 | 98.85149993 - 98.52824811 |
159-150 | 98.49801724 -98.09290531 |
149-140 | 98.07460288 - 97.54301298 |
139-130 | 97.4927496 - 96.87838902 |
129-120 | 96.80927687 - 96.0687115 |
119-110 | 95.983027 - 95.05625037 |
109-100 | 94.96737888 - 93.8020333 |
99-90 | 93.67910655 - 92.21882783 |
89-80 | 92.05811248 - 90.27631202 |
79-70 | 90.0448455 - 87.51810893 |
69-60 | 87.33654157 - 83.89085926 |
59-50 | 83.5119717 - 78.35114254 |
49-40 | 77.81927947 - 69.5797271 |
39-30 | 68.80219265 - 56.09102043 |
29-20 | 54.01037138 - 36.58463962 |
19-10 | 35.2885364 - 18.16647924 |
9-0 | 17.14582299 -5.71472799 |
